This is an RFC on a simpler and less intrusive way of setting
up port flags on the mixed SATA/PATA Promise TX2plus chips.
The #promise-sata-pata branch requires libata core to be updated
with a per-port flags array in the ata_probe_ent structure. I
guess you don't approve of that solution.
This alternative patch is based on the observation that ap->flags
isn't really used until after ->port_start() has been invoked.
So this patch places the "exceptional" per-port flags array in
the driver's private host structure, and uses it in ->port_start()
to finalise the flags.
This patch also eliminates #promise-sata-pata's redundant code
formatting changes, and eliminates the redundant port_flags[]
assignments for the SATA-only TX4 chips.
